Hungarian Broadcaster orders SSL MT Plus

Hungarian national and regional broadcaster, Magyar Radio, is to install SSL's MT Plus Digital Multitrack Console in Studio 22 in its Budapest broadcasting centre.



The 32-fader, 64 channel MT Plus is scheduled for delivery in November when it will be employed on a variety of tasks ranging from music recording and mixing to film scoring and live broadcasting.

Studio 22 has a large 280 square metre live area that has long played host to Hungary's world-renowned orchestras, chamber music ensembles and choirs. Significantly, Studio 22 also serves as the scoring stage for the Budapest Film Orchestra - which draws on a pool of talent from three of the most successful orchestras in the capital; the National Philharmonic, The State Opera Orchestra and the Festival Orchestra.

The many projects scored at Studio 22 in recent years for both theatrical and TV release include 'Young Indiana Jones Chronicles,' 'Catherine the Great,' and 'Mulan.'
